When diving into the world of filter presses, it's essential to understand what they are and how they function. A filter press is a crucial equipment used for liquid-Solid Separation. Industries widely apply it for wasteWater Treatment, mineral processing, and food manufacturing. It works by forcing a slurry through filter plates. This process separates liquids from solids, resulting in clearer filtrate and drier cakes.
Tips for selecting the right filter press include understanding your specific needs. Consider the slurry characteristics, such as viscosity and particle size. Knowing the volume you need to process is equally important. Always evaluate the material of the filter plates. Different materials offer varied durability and chemical resistance.

When considering filter presses, it’s essential to understand the various types available on the market. Plate Filter Presses are widely used for their efficiency in separating solids from liquids. They consist of a series of plates and frames that hold a filter cloth, allowing for effective filtration. The design is straightforward, but the selection should align with your specific needs.
Another common type is the chamber filter press. This version has deeper chambers, making it suitable for larger volumes of slurry. It can handle more complex materials, but may require more maintenance. Each type of filter press has its advantages and drawbacks, so reflecting on your operational requirements is crucial.

When selecting materials for filter press components, the choice significantly impacts performance and durability. Common materials include stainless steel, polypropylene, and rubber. These materials are favored for their resistance to chemicals and wear. For instance, reports indicate that stainless steel offers superior strength and longevity, making it ideal for high-pressure applications. Meanwhile, polypropylene is lightweight and corrosion-resistant, often used in municipal wastewater treatment settings.

Belt pressure filters have emerged as a pivotal tool in the realm of solid-liquid separation, due to their remarkable filtration efficiency and energy-saving capabilities. These systems are designed to handle substantial processing capacities while ensuring high dehydration efficiency and minimizing operational costs. The innovative inclined elongated wedge zone design not only stabilizes the filtration process but also enhances throughput, catering to industries that demand robust separation solutions.
According to recent industry reports, belt pressure filters can achieve solid contents in filter cakes that are considerably higher than traditional methods, making them indispensable in sectors such as mining, wastewater treatment, and chemical processing. The advanced engineering of multi-roll diameter decreasing type backlog rollers allows for a compact layout that maintains high performance, contributing to lower energy consumption without sacrificing processing capacity.
